--- title: 'Customer Success Agent at Slash Financial' canonical: 'https://feeny.ai/job/customer-success-agent-slash-financial-remote-7v9nfhg35sbr' type: 'job' last_seen: '2026-09-10' --- # Customer Success Agent at Slash Financial - **Company:** Slash Financial - **Location:** Remote - **Compensation:** $55k–$70k - **Employment:** full-time - **Work type:** remote - **Posted:** 2026-07-06 - **Last confirmed live:** 2026-09-10 - **Apply:** https://jobs.ashbyhq.com/slash-financial/2c54ef2c-da99-4ef1-a5c8-e0fba803e219 ## Job description ## About Slash Slash is building the future of business banking, one industry at a time. We believe businesses deserve financial infrastructure tailored to how they actually operate. That's why we're creating a new category of business banking. We combine the reliability of traditional banking (high yields, competitive rewards, and comprehensive security) with industry-specific features that make businesses more efficient, more competitive, and more profitable. Started in 2021, Slash is one of the fastest growing fintechs in the world and we power over three billion dollars a year in business purchasing across numerous industries. We're backed by some of the best investors in the world including Menlo Ventures, NEA, Y Combinator, Stanford University, and the founders of Tinder and Plaid. Slash is headquartered in San Francisco, and has a strong in-person culture. We’re growing fast and are looking for sharp, detail-oriented Customer Success Agent to join our team! The Role: As a Customer Success Agent, you will play an important role in ensuring our customers have an excellent experience while maintaining the highest standards of compliance with our platform. What You’ll Do: - Handle customer success and support operations, working closely with our product, sales, and engineering teams. - Document and automate customer operation processes where possible. - Conduct customer support: Serve as a first point of contact for customer questions via phone, email, and dashboard. - Troubleshoot account issues, guide customers through onboarding, and resolve inquiries efficiently. - Review new customer onboarding applications. - Write FAQs and internal playbooks to make our customer experience faster and easier. - Managing inbound support tickets and calls with professionalism and empathy. What We’re Looking For: - 2+ years in financial services, customer support/success or sales/BDR experience preferred. - Strong attention to detail and excellent written/verbal communication skills. - Comfortable handling sensitive information and exercising discretion. - Ability to work independently, prioritize tasks, and meet deadlines. - Experience with Intercom, Pylon, or similar tools a plus but not required. - Familiarity with AML, KYB/KYC, or transaction monitoring preferred but not required (we’ll train you). - Ability to work Day Shift - PST or EST hours (9am-6pm) Why Join Slash: - Be part of a fast-growing fintech startup disrupting business finance. - Work closely with compliance leadership to develop in-demand skills in AML and risk operations. - Opportunity to grow into high-impact compliance roles as we scale. - On-Site or Remote opportunity! ## About Slash Financial ## Company Overview - **One-liner**: Slash provides a modern, all-in-one business banking, corporate cards, and treasury platform, reimagining financial services for specific industries. - **Entity Type**: Private (Series C) - **Headquarters**: San Francisco, California, USA - **Founded**: 2021 - **Founders**: Victor Cardenas (CEO) and Kevin Bai (CRO) ## Core Business - Primary industry/industries: Financial Technology (Fintech), Business Banking, Payments - Target customers: B2B, targeting businesses of all sizes from startups to enterprises (Silver/Gold/Black tiers based on payment volume) - Mission or purpose statement: To build a higher standard in business finance by moving beyond one-size-fits-all banking, combining the reliability of traditional banking with industry-specific features to make businesses more efficient, competitive, and profitable. ## Products & Services - **Business Banking**: High-yield FDIC-insured accounts with enhanced coverage up to hundreds of millions, multi-entity management, and granular user controls. - **Corporate Cards**: Unlimited virtual and physical cards with cashback rewards, advanced spend controls, and multi-step payment approvals. Cards are issued by Column N.A., under a license from Visa U.S.A. Inc. - **Treasury & Cash Management**: Tools for managing company funds, including high-yield accounts and automated top-ups. - **Slash API**: Developer-friendly APIs for read and write access, enabling automation of payments, stablecoin on/off ramps, and multi-entity financial management. - **Crypto & Stablecoin Services**: Seamless conversion between fiat and crypto within the app, including stablecoin on and off ramps. - **Global Payments & Reconciliation**: Support for domestic and international wire transfers, same-day ACH, and real-time payments (FedNow/RTP) with reporting and reconciliation tools. - **Working Capital**: Flexible credit options for businesses to fuel growth. ## Market Standing - **Valuation**: $1.4 billion (as of Series C in April 2026). - **Key Metric** (Total Funding): Over $160 million raised. - **Key Metric** (Volume): Over $30 billion in yearly payment volume, $35 billion+ in virtual cards issued, and 5 million+ cards issued. - **Notable Investors/Partners**: Y Combinator (S21 batch), NEA, Goodwater Capital, Stanford University, and federally regulated bank partner Column N.A. (Member FDIC). - **Growth Signals**: Raised a $100M Series C in April 2026, reaching a $1.4B valuation. In 2024, the company surpassed $1B in annualized volume, launched multiple new products (Corporate Cards, API, Global Payments, Real-Time Payments), and secured a $41.6M Series B. By 2025, annualized volume hit $3B. The company serves over 6,000 businesses. ## Competitive Advantages - **Industry-Specific Approach**: Unlike one-size-fits-all competitors (like Ramp or Brex), Slash deeply studies workflows across verticals to tailor its banking platform, giving it a strong moat in specific industries. - **Unified Platform**: Combines banking, cards, treasury, crypto, and API access on a single platform, simplifying financial operations for businesses. - **Founding Team & Backing**: Founded by teenagers and backed by top-tier investors (Y Combinator, NEA, Goodwater), signaling strong execution and market confidence. - **Security & Compliance**: SOC2 Type II and PCI compliant, with enhanced FDIC insurance through a network of 800+ banks and partnerships with federally regulated banks. ## Strategic Focus - **Deepening Industry Verticals**: Continuing to build industry-specific features and partnerships (e.g., with accounting firms and healthcare) to capture more market share. - **Product Expansion**: Scaling its API, global payments, stablecoin infrastructure, and working capital products to become the primary financial operating system for businesses. - **Scaling Customer Base**: Moving upmarket (Black tier for $100M+ volume) while serving SMBs, aiming to displace traditional banks and legacy fintechs. ## Why Work Here - **Culture**: Described as "100% hardcore in-person culture" with a strong emphasis on collaboration, hard work, and ambition.
